My winch did not noticeably change my lift height in front. I think you'll be happy with that setup. I bought the same kit with the trackbars. It's very complete and great for 33's with a lower stance.

About the stock control arms. They're fine for that lift but I can show you how easy the rear lower arms bend on a rock. The front arms are fine. Roman has a great idea for boxing them up. Just get some 1" steel square tubing and drop them in the stock arms and weld them in.
